Kelleher and Pentore of Horvath & Tremblay broker $15 million sale of The Residences at Trowbridge - a 28-unit apartment building

Cambridge, MA Dennis Kelleher and John Pentore of Horvath & Tremblay have completed the sale of The Residences at Trowbridge, a 28-unit apartment building. The duo exclusively represented the seller and procured the buyer to complete the transaction at a sale price of $15 million

Girvin of Chandler Company LLC handles $1.7 million sale of a 2,329 s/f retail condominium in Boston

Boston, MA Kenneth Girvin of Chandler Company LLC has brokered the sale of 401 Harrison Ave. (aka 40 Fay St., H-112), for $1.7 million. The buyer was 40 Fay Owner LLC and the seller was Mundy’s Asia Galleries LLC. Sam Hawkey of Tactical Realty Group represented the buyer.

Atlantic Commercial Real Estate, LLC leases 1,200 s/f of office space

Norwood, MA Atlantic Commercial Real Estate, LLC leased 1,200 s/f of office space in 175 Walpole St., to Century 21 Northeast. This transaction concludes the lease-up of this multi-use property. Atlantic Commercial represented the landlord in the transaction.
